Require confirmation for updated email addresses – 3900.125

To enhance security and ensure reliable communication, we added a verification step when users update their email address in Blackboard. Now, whenever a user changes their email, a confirmation message is sent to the new address. The user must verify the new email before the change takes effect. This helps prevent issues caused by typos or incorrect addresses, ensuring users continue to receive important communications without interruption. 

Image 1. Users have the option to resend the confirmation email from their profile.

The Basic Information section of the Profile page, featuring a message beneath the email address that says: "A confirmation email was sent to newemail@anthology.com. Check your inbox or spam folder to verify your email."
